The Alpha Camara Nursery School serves the community of a small village near Georgetown. The school is built on land owned by the Camara family who have given it to the village. The school is run by three volunteer teachers. Children are able to attend free of charge.

There are eight other communities nearby with no nursery facilities: at present the school does not have room to take in children from neighbouring villages, but would like to be able to do so. Two rooms are presently not in use and they need to be cemented and furnished.

Via the World Food Programme, lunch is provided each day for the pupils.

At present 53 students attend.

So far the charity has supported the school with donations of books and educational materials. We are currently investigating other ways in which we can assist.
